Avionic Fix
Airman 1st Class Chaz Bucholtz, an Avionics Intermediate Support technician with the 379th Expeditionary Maintenance Squadron, replaces an A9 board from an analog/digital converter off of an F-15 Eagle APG-70 radar, Feb. 11, 2009, in an undisclosed location in Southwest Asia. The radar system reads the surroundings of the aircraft for navigational purposes and lets the F-15 pilot know the location of other aircraft are in the area. Airman Bucholtz is native to Dayton, Ohio and is deployed from Royal Air Force, Lakenheath, England in support of Operations Iraqi and Enduring Freedom and Combined Joint Task Force - Horn of Africa.
